Saturday, March 14th
John 7:25-36

Nothing is outside Our care, concern and Keeping. Only those who wilfully reject Our love and leading put themselves beyond Our power to bring them to perfection and fulfilment in the Father's Presence at the end of time. For every child of the loving Heavenly Father is free to choose his direction and his destiny. All at some time deviate from the way We lead and guide. Lovingly We welcome their return as they discover the foolishness and danger of their wanderings from the way and bind the wounds of all the fallen. As they learn from their mistakes and failures so are they strengthened, fortified as they commit themselves to Our saving, sanctifying love.

I came to earth that all might have that life the Father yearns to give to every one of His beloved children. And all who turn from sin and service of the self receive that life according to the measure of their commitment to Our light and leading; for Our saving, sanctifying love progresses each and every one.

We grieve until the end of time for those who, though designed and destined for perfection and fulfilment in the Father's Presence choose rather to reject their glorious destiny.
